This traffic camera monitors 1200 blk 4th St NE s/b in Washington, D.C.. The camera sits on the 1200 block of 4th St s/b in NE. The posted limit at this location is 20 mph. It recorded about 971 violations in the latest reported year, roughly $242,750 in fines. Violation counts come from Washington, D.C.'s published enforcement data; revenue is estimated from violation volume and posted fine amounts.
